VDM '88. VDM (Vienna development method) - The way ahead. 2nd VDM-Europe symposium, Dublin, Ireland, September 11-16, 1988. Proceedings (Q1188528)
From MaRDI portal
| This is the item page for this Wikibase entity, intended for internal use and editing purposes. Please use this page instead for the normal view: VDM '88. VDM (Vienna development method) - The way ahead. 2nd VDM-Europe symposium, Dublin, Ireland, September 11-16, 1988. Proceedings |
scientific article; zbMATH DE number 41832
| Language | Label | Description | Also known as |
|---|---|---|---|
| English | VDM '88. VDM (Vienna development method) - The way ahead. 2nd VDM-Europe symposium, Dublin, Ireland, September 11-16, 1988. Proceedings |
scientific article; zbMATH DE number 41832 |
Statements
VDM '88. VDM (Vienna development method) - The way ahead. 2nd VDM-Europe symposium, Dublin, Ireland, September 11-16, 1988. Proceedings (English)
0 references
17 September 1992
0 references
The articles of this volume will not be indexed individually. Die Vienna development method (VDM) ist eine formale Methode zur Beschreibung und schrittweisen Entwicklung von Software-Systemen, die in der Praxis immer häufiger eingesetzt wird. Dabei basiert die Beschreibung auf einem Zustandsmodell und Operationen, die durch sogenannte Pre- und Post-Conditions definiert sind. Die Entwicklung beginnt mit der System-Spezifikation und endet mit der Implementierung des Systems. Jeder Entwicklungsschritt wird bezüglich des vorhergehenden als korrekt nachgewiesen. Für die Formulierung der Beweise steht der Kalkül der Prädikatenlogik zur Verfügung. In die Beschreibungssprache Meta-IV von VDM sind viele Aspekte der von Landin, Scott and Strachey entwickelten denotationellen Semantik eingeflossen. Das vorliegende Buch enthält Ausarbeitungen von Vorträgen, die auf dem zweiten VDM-Europe Symposium 1988 in Dublin gehalten wurden. Es gliedert sich inhaltlich in mehrere Teile, die jeweils bestimmte Aspekte von VDM behandeln. Die einführenden Referate geben einen Einblick in die VDM-Spezifikationsprache und behandeln insbesondere Strukturierungsaspekte und Verifikationstechniken. Eine breiten Raum nehmen die Anwendungen ein. Neben dem traditionellen Anwendungsgebiet Compiler-Konstruktion wird die Standardisierung von Programmiersprachen (Modula-2) und Software-Systemen (GKS) mit in VDM formulierten Spezifikationen ausführlich behandelt. Weitere Schwerpunkte sind Software-Entwicklungsumgebungen für VDM, Standardisierung von VDM und Erfahrungsberichte über den Einsatz von VDM bei der Realisierung großer Software-Systeme, wodurch die zunehmende Bedeutung von VDM für die industrielle Software-Produktion belegt wird. Zahlreiche Referate, in denen VDM mit anderen Software-Spezifikationsmethoden verglichen wird, und einige Beiträge zur theoretischen Fundierung von VDM runden den Band ab. Durch das vorliegende Buch erhält der Leser einen guten Überblick über den aktuellen Entwicklungsstand von VDM, wobei allerdings für die genaue Lektüre der meisten Beiträge weitgehende theoretische Vorkenntnisse notwending sind.
0 references
VDM-88
0 references
Vienna development method
0 references
Proceedings
0 references
Symposium
0 references
Dublin (Ireland)
0 references
software engineering
0 references
software verification
0 references
software correctness
0 references
standarization
0 references
denotational semantics
0 references
GKS
0 references
Modula-2
0 references
0.8333531022071838
0 references
0.799740731716156
0 references